The Marketplace Minefield: Where “Free” Turns Fatal
“Free” engines thrive on marketplaces. Character models, environment assets, sound effects. They all come at a price. Need a decent fire effect? $50. A usable AI script? $100. A polished UI? Prepare to empty your wallet. These aren’t optional extras. They are the building blocks of your game.
The engine is the gateway drug. The marketplace is the addiction. What started as a cost-saving measure morphs into a bottomless pit. Your vision becomes a hostage, your budget, a ransom.
Example: Imagine developing a stylized RPG. The “free” engine is tempting. High-quality character models, detailed environment assets, and custom animations are required. Marketplace costs quickly escalate, exceeding the price of a premium engine license.
Challenge: Over-reliance on pre-made assets breeds mediocrity. The market is saturated with generic-looking games. Stand out by investing in original content. Develop unique assets, even if it means a steeper initial investment. The payoff will be worth it.

Plugin Predation: The Price of Functionality
“Free” engines often lack essential features. Advanced physics, realistic AI, robust networking. These are all locked behind plugin paywalls. They aren’t optional extras. They’re integral to creating a compelling game.
The development process becomes a constant battle between your vision and your budget. Each plugin is another compromise. The costs mount relentlessly.
Step-by-Step Descent: Developing a multiplayer online battle arena (MOBA).
- The “free” engine lacks a reliable networking solution.
- Researching and comparing available networking plugins.
- A suitable plugin is identified. Cost: $100 per month subscription.
- Integrating the plugin requires specialized coding expertise.
- Ongoing maintenance and bug fixes incur additional costs. Each step drains your resources and delays the game’s release.
Mistake: Failing to account for plugin costs in the initial budget. Underestimating the true cost of essential functionality. Project timelines spiral out of control. Financial pressure intensifies. Plan carefully. Prioritize necessary plugins. Seek out affordable alternatives.

Licensing Landmines: Navigating the Legal Labyrinth
“Free” engines come with complex, often restrictive, licensing agreements. These agreements can stifle your creative freedom. They can impose unexpected obligations. Ignoring them can be catastrophic.
Some licenses demand open-source distribution of your game. Others grant the engine developer ownership of your intellectual property. Thoroughly scrutinize the fine print before committing to a “free” engine. The legal landscape is littered with traps. One misstep can destroy your studio.
Case Study: An indie studio releases a successful game under a seemingly permissive open-source license. A large corporation copies the game’s core mechanics, releasing a competing title. The studio lacks legal recourse. Their ignorance costs them everything.
Mistake: Neglecting to read and understand the licensing terms. Failing to seek professional legal advice. Not understanding your rights and obligations. Leaving your intellectual property vulnerable to exploitation. Consult with a lawyer specializing in intellectual property law.
Performance Penalties: Paying the Optimization Tax
“Free” engines often suffer from poor optimization. Games experience frame rate drops, stuttering, and crashes. Optimizing the engine requires specialized knowledge and significant time investment. Your game becomes sluggish and unresponsive.
This creates a critical disadvantage, especially for resource-intensive games. The “free” engine becomes a bottleneck, limiting the game’s potential. Your players suffer the consequences.
Step-by-Step Optimization Agony:
- Profile your game using specialized debugging tools.
- Identify performance bottlenecks. CPU-bound or GPU-bound?
- Optimize your code to minimize CPU usage.
- Optimize your assets to reduce memory consumption.
- Adjust graphics settings to improve frame rates.
- Test the game on a wide range of hardware configurations. Performance optimization is a continuous struggle, demanding constant vigilance.
Challenge: Mastering advanced performance optimization techniques. Understanding the engine’s architecture and limitations. Overcoming hardware constraints. Expect frustration, long hours, and incremental improvements.
Vendor Vortex: Trapped in a Golden Cage
Investing time and resources into a “free” engine creates a trap. Switching to another engine becomes increasingly difficult. This is vendor lock-in. You become a prisoner of your own choices.
Retraining your team, rewriting your code, re-importing your assets. These are costly, time-consuming, and emotionally draining processes. The initial decision now dictates your destiny. Escape is almost impossible.
Example: A developer spends years building a complex, ambitious RPG using a “free” engine. The engine proves inadequate for the project’s scope. Switching engines would require a complete rewrite of the game. The project collapses. The investment is lost. The developer’s dream dies.
Pitfall: Committing to an engine without careful evaluation. Failing to consider the long-term implications. Ignoring the risk of vendor lock-in. Test the engine thoroughly. Prototype key gameplay mechanics. Evaluate its suitability for your specific needs.

Avoiding the Abyss: Practical Steps to Take Now
Don’t be a victim. Arm yourself with knowledge and a healthy dose of skepticism. Here’s how to navigate the treacherous terrain of “free” game engines and avoid the pitfalls that await.
1. Due Diligence is Key: Before even downloading a “free” engine, conduct thorough research. Read reviews from multiple sources, paying close attention to complaints about hidden costs, performance issues, and licensing restrictions. Explore the engine’s documentation to assess its complexity. Download the engine and create a small prototype to evaluate its ease of use.
2. Project Your Costs, Honestly: Create a detailed budget that accounts for all potential expenses, including marketplace assets, plugins, training materials, and legal fees. Don’t underestimate the cost of these essential elements. Compare the projected costs of using a “free” engine with the cost of purchasing a paid engine license. You may be surprised to find that the “free” option is actually more expensive in the long run.
3. Read the Fine Print, Then Read It Again: Carefully review the engine’s licensing agreement, paying close attention to restrictions on commercial use, royalty obligations, and intellectual property ownership. Don’t hesitate to seek legal advice if you have any questions or concerns. Understanding your rights and obligations is crucial for protecting your creative work.
4. Community Engagement, with a Grain of Salt: While online communities can be valuable resources, it’s important to approach them with caution. Be wary of overly enthusiastic endorsements and unsubstantiated claims. Look for objective reviews and balanced perspectives. Always verify information from multiple sources before making decisions.
5. Plan for the Inevitable Switch: Even if you’re initially satisfied with a “free” engine, it’s wise to plan for the possibility of switching to another engine in the future. Design your project in a modular way, separating the core game logic from the engine-specific code. This will make it easier to migrate your project to a different platform if necessary.
6. Diversify Your Skills: Don’t rely solely on pre-made assets and plugins. Invest time in learning how to create your own content, including character models, environment assets, and sound effects. This will give you greater control over your project and reduce your dependence on external resources.
7. Consider Alternatives: Explore other game development options, such as open-source engines, cross-platform frameworks, and custom-built solutions. There are many alternatives to “free” engines that offer greater flexibility, control, and cost-effectiveness.
8. The Prototype is Your Friend: Before sinking significant time into any game engine, create a prototype. This allows you to test core mechanics, assess performance, and get a feel for the engine’s workflow. The prototype will help identify potential problems early on and prevent costly mistakes down the road.
